What matters most
Photometric units sit beside the ball and only need to see impact — they work in rooms as shallow as 10–14 feet. Radar units need 18+ feet of total room depth. If your room is under 16 feet deep, you're buying photometric. Full stop.
Wide enclosures, full-stance hitting platforms, and tower PCs all consume space you don't have. Mini PCs, narrower screens, and integrated launch monitors save floor area.
If you're renting, the Net Return Pro Series and similar portable setups don't require any permanent modifications.
"Minimum recommended" from manufacturers is often optimistic. We use realistic real-world numbers from community testing, not spec sheets.
In low-ceiling rooms, overhead-mounted units like the Uneekor EYE XO2 simply don't fit. Side-mounted units (SkyTrak+, Square Golf Omni) do.
